Hot! Hot! Hot!
Was Oxnard really the nation’s hot spot this weekend (B1)? . . . Some meteorologists say placement of a thermometer near the tarmac at Oxnard Airport leads to exaggerated readings. Meanwhile, residents up the coast in Santa Ynez and several other cities reached triple digits--numbers not inflated by scorching asphalt.
Capital Cases
Two men face possible death sentences in murder trials scheduled to begin this week in Ventura County Superior Court (B1). . . . One, whose case began jury selection Monday, is Alan Brett Holland, a 29-year-old Hollywood drifter accused in the fatal shooting of a woman in a Ventura parking lot. The other is Michael Raymond Johnson, charged with shooting to death a deputy who answered a domestic-disturbance call at his estranged wife’s home in Meiners Oaks.
Gleeful Golf
Golfer Paul Stankowski, originally from Oxnard, celebrates his victory in one of nine events that made up the EMC Golf Skills Challenge at the Ojai Valley Inn and Spa on Monday (C8) . . . He was one of eight pros competing in a show to be televised next month. Stankowski placed fifth in the overall competition; the leader of the field--taking a $50,000 bonus--was little-known pro Billy Andrade.
Business Sprouts
Seminis Vegetable Seeds, a company formed by the merger of two seed companies, has found fertile ground for a new consolidated office and processing facility (D15D). . . . The company recently ended its long search for a new home with the purchase of a 32-acre parcel within Oxnard’s McInnes Ranch business park. The transaction was one of several that took place at the 10-year-old park in the past few months.
